Why Roseville patients choose a one-roof practice
The usual implant path in Placer County involves three stops: your general dentist refers you out for a CT scan, an oral surgeon places the implant, and then you come back months later for the crown. Each stop bills separately, and each one adds a wait.
Dr. Cheema handles all of it. The scan is taken here on the day of your consultation at no charge, the surgery is done here, and our in-house lab mills the zirconia-backed crown. Fewer hand-offs means fewer fees and a treatment timeline you can actually plan around.
What your free Roseville consultation includes
You get a 3D cone beam CT scan, a review of bone volume and nerve position, a written treatment plan, and an exact price before anything is scheduled. Many Roseville offices charge $200 to $350 for the scan alone; we do not charge for it and there is no obligation to book treatment.
If bone grafting, an extraction or a sinus lift is needed, it is quoted line by line in that same plan so the total never moves after the fact.
Insurance and payment for Roseville patients
We accept most major dental insurance plans, and while implants are not covered by Medicare or Medicaid, many PPO plans contribute toward the crown or the extraction. Interest-free financing is available for patients who would rather spread the cost over months.
The $1,850 fee is our cash and non-insurance rate. If you have insurance, we will run a benefits check and show you what your plan is likely to pay before you commit.

Common questions from Roseville
- How long does a dental implant take in Roseville?
- Placement itself takes about an hour. The implant then integrates with the bone for roughly three to four months before the crown is attached. Some cases qualify for a same-day temporary tooth.
